Abstract: | Specific rates of Hg (203HgCl2) methylation and McHg (14CH3HgI) demethylation in aerobic and anaerobic conditions were determined in samples of surface sediments (0 to 2 cm) taken from
five small headwater lakes in Southern Finland. The highest rates of methylation were measured in anaerobic conditions. However,
the importance of aerobic methylation increased with increasing Fe and Mn content in sediment. There was little difference
between aerobic and anaerobic demethylation. The results demonstrate that the net McHg production in lake sediments depends
on the individual characteristics of the lake, particularly pH and and sediment properties. These characteristics seem to
affect demethylation in anaerobic conditions and methylation in aerobic conditions. |
